Hello! My name is Madison, and I am currently a first year graduate student in Columbia University's MS in Climate program. I recently graduated from UC Berkeley with an Honors BS in Environmental Sciences, along with minors in Chinese and Environmental Economics and Policy. My academic path has spanned climate and data science, environmental economics, sustainability, and Chinese language. Throughout my undergraduate career, I was most inspired by professors and teaching assistants who taught with passion and enthusiasm, and who worked collaboratively and patiently with students to deepen their understanding. I strive to bring the same energy and approach to my own tutoring, creating an encouraging space where students feel supported, engaged, and confident. By combining clear explanations, real-world examples, and repetitive practice, I help students turn challenging concepts into skills they can confidently apply on their own.
I have three years of tutoring experience through the RISE program Berkeley High School, which supports students from low-income and marginalized communities. I assisted with homework, essay writing, and college applications, working one-on-one with students. I worked with all grade levels in subjects including Algebra, Geometry, Trigonometry, Pre-Calculus, Calculus 1, Chemistry, Biology, Economics, History, and English. I begin by having students share what they know or how they would approach a problem, then build on that foundation by explaining relevant concepts and breaking down complex problems into smaller steps. For more abstract topics, I use fun examples to make the material more relatable. Afterward, I ask students to explain what they learned and solve a similar problem to reinforce confidence and understanding.
